What exactly is a Google Drive link?
📎 A Google Drive link is a. URL address which points to a file or folder stored in the Google cloud.
This link can be public or private, and its behavior depends on how the owner has configured it.
When you receive a link, you are not receiving the file itself, but rather a remote access which can vary between preview, download or edit.

What to do if you cannot open the link
😕 It often happens that, upon clicking, the dreaded message appears: "You do not have permission to access this file.".
This happens because the owner has not properly configured the visibility.
In such cases, you have three options:
- Click on "Request access" and wait for authorization.
- Ask the sender to change it to mode "Anyone with the link".
- Log in with the correct Google accountSometimes the error is due to being connected to another account.
Types of permissions on Google Drive links
🔑 Not all links work the same, and it pays to know the differences.
- Read only 👀You can view the document but not modify it.
- Comment 💬allows you to add remarks without altering the content.
- Edition ✍️You have full control to modify the file.
👉 Make sure the sender gives you the proper permission based on what you need to do.
How to recognize if the link is secure
⚠️ Not all Google Drive links are reliable.
Although Google Drive is secure, some people use it to share suspicious content.
Before opening, check:
- Let the link begin with https://drive.google.com/.
- That you receive it from someone you trust.
- Not an executable (.exe) or rare compressed (.zip) file sent by strangers.

How to open a folder link in Google Drive
📂 Not only individual files are shared, but also entire folders.
When you open a folder link, you will see all the documents it contains.
From there, you can:
- Download all the content in a .zip file.
- Copy the files to your own Drive.
- Access each document individually.

What to do if the Google Drive link does not work
❌ Sometimes the problem is not yours, but the link itself.
May be:
- The owner has deleted it.
- The link is incorrectly copied (missing characters).
- The URL has expired if it was a temporary access.
In such cases, the only thing you can do is to ask the sender to resend it.
